Depuis 2011, iMzu Tours a organisé plus de 43 000 visites de townships et connecté des milliers de touristes supplémentaires avec les communautés de townships du Cap, enrichissant ainsi la vie des touristes, et par leur présence, la vie matérielle des habitants, car Mzu Lembeni, propriétaire d'iMzu Tours, croit en « le partage de l'amour ». Ayant appris ce qui est possible grâce à sa propre expérience de grandir dans une cabane en tôle ondulée et de commencer sa vie professionnelle à l'adolescence en travaillant dans une arrière-cuisine, il s'est consacré à autonomiser les communautés des townships qu'il appelle chez lui, en créant des emplois locaux et en aidant les habitants enthousiastes à faire avancer et à éloigner les townships de leur histoire d'apartheid. Chaque visite Imzu, à pied ou à vélo, met en valeur le style de vie et la fierté qui ronflent les townships de Langa et Khayelitsha, en mettant en valeur ce qui est possible. Visitez un centre d'art et d'artisanat local. Voir les artisans et les artistes locaux au travail. Avoir la possibilité d'acheter leur travail.
Visitez les habitants des environs. Visitez un Shebeen local (pub informel) et goûtez à la bière locale. Marche pour visiter les stands de rue
